backend-drm: few cosmetic changes related to struct drm_colorop_3x1d_lut
Move struct to another part of the header, change a few variable/param names and replace an useless u64 by u32. Signed-off-by: Leandro Ribeiro <leandro.ribeiro@collabora.com>
